Ketoprofen (OrudisKT [human OTCtablet]; Ketofen[veterinary injection])
NSAID. Antiinflammatoryagent. Used to treatarthritis and otherinflammatory disorders.
All NSAIDs share similaradverse effect of GItoxicity. Ketoprofen hasbeen administered for 5consecutive days in dogswithout serious adverseeffects. Most commonside effect is vomiting. GIulceration is possible insome animals.
Although not approved inthe US, ketoprofen isapproved for smallanimals in other countries.Doses listed are based onapproved use in thosecountries. It is available asOTC drug for humans inthe US.
12.5 mg tablet(OTC); 25, 50,75 mg Rx humanform; 100 mg/mLinjection for horses.
1 mg/kg q24h po for upto 5 days. Initial dose canbe given via injection atup to 2 mg/kg SC, IM, IV.
Ketorolactromethamine(Toradol)
NSAID. Used for short-termrelief of pain andinflammation. Acts byinhibiting cyclooxygenaseenzyme (COX). Use ofketorolac has beenevaluated clinically in dogsbut not cats.
NSAIDs may cause GIulceration. Ketorolac maycause GI lesions ifadministered morefrequently than q8h. Donot administer more than2 doses.
Available as 10 mg tabletand injection for IV or IMuse. Clinical studies indogs have shown safetyand efficacy. Dosing q12his recommended to avoidGI problems.
10 mg tablets; 15and 30 mg/mLinjection, in 10%alcohol.
Dog: 0.5 mg/kg q8–12hpo, IM, IV.Cat: safe dose notestablished.
Levamisolehydrochloride(Levasole, Tramisol,Ergamisol)
Antiparasitic drug of theimidazothiazole class.Mechanism of action dueto neuromuscular toxicityto parasites. Levamisole hasbeen used forendoparasites in dogs andas microfilaricide.Levamisole has also beenused as animmunostimulant;however, clinical reports ofits efficacy are not available.
May produce cholinergictoxicity. May causevomiting in some dogs.
In heartworm-positivedogs, it may sterilizefemale adult heartworms.
0.184 g bolus;11.7 g per 13 gpacket; 50 mg tablet(Ergamisol).
Dog: hookworms,5–8 mg/kg once po (up to10 mg/kg po for 2 days);microfilaricide, 10 mg/kgq24h po for 6–10 days;immunostimulant,0.5–2 mg/kg 3 times/weekpo.Cat: endoparasites,4.4 mg/kg once po;lungworms, 20–40 mg/kgq48h for 5 treatments po.
